What companies run services between Switzerland and Trafoi, Italy?

There is no direct connection from Switzerland to Trafoi. However, you can take the train to Zürich HB, take the train to Landquart, take the train to Klosters Platz, take the train to Scuol-Tarasp, then drive to Trafoi. Alternatively, you can take a train from Zürich Stadelhofen to Trafoi, Parcheggio via Zürich HB, Zuerich Hb, Landeck-Zams, Landeck-Zams Bahnhof, Malles - Stazione, and Prato a.Stelvio, P.Principale in around 9h 32m.
